Program Details
Provides professionals with advanced skills and tools to collect data, analyze it and interpret results across a wide variety of high-tech companies. The techniques learned can be applied to quality control, production design and analysis, telecommunications, financial analysis and risk analysis.
What You Will Learn:
Students in the Applied Statistical Methods Graduate Certificate Program will learn a wide range of leadership and management skills in addition to the following skills:
- Role and purpose of applied statistics (summary measures for quantitative/qualitative data, random behavior modeling, computational statistical inference, linear regression analysis and inference, and more).
- Regression models and the least squares criterion.
- Role of sample surveys, sampling design and different sampling methods.
- Fixed and random effect models and ANOVA, block design, Latin square design, factorial and fractional factorial designs and their analysis.
- Statistical software such as JMP, SAS and S-plus.
- Times-series and naïve-forecasting models, estimation and forecasting for ARMA models and nonseasonal and seasonal ARIMA models, and more.
